The Future of Web Development: Trends to Watch in 2024

January 15, 2024 - 2 min read

The web development landscape is constantly evolving, with new technologies and frameworks emerging every year. In 2024, we’re seeing a shift towards more performant, accessible, and user-centric web applications.

Performance-First Development

Performance has become the cornerstone of modern web development. Users expect lightning-fast loading times, and search engines are increasingly prioritizing Core Web Vitals in their ranking algorithms.

Key Performance Metrics

  • Largest Contentful Paint (LCP): Measures loading performance
  • First Input Delay (FID): Measures interactivity
  • Cumulative Layout Shift (CLS): Measures visual stability

The Rise of Modern Frameworks

Frameworks like Astro, Next.js, and SvelteKit are gaining popularity for their ability to deliver optimal performance while maintaining developer experience.

Why Astro Stands Out

Astro’s unique approach to partial hydration allows developers to ship less JavaScript to the browser, resulting in faster page loads and better user experience.

AI-Powered Development Tools

Artificial intelligence is revolutionizing how we write and debug code. Tools like GitHub Copilot and similar AI assistants are becoming indispensable for developers.

Benefits of AI in Development

  • Faster code generation
  • Improved code quality
  • Reduced debugging time
  • Enhanced learning opportunities

Web Components and Micro-Frontends

The adoption of Web Components is growing, enabling developers to create reusable, framework-agnostic components that work across different environments.

Advantages of Web Components

  • Reusability: Components can be used across different frameworks
  • Encapsulation: Styles and logic are isolated
  • Standards-based: Built on web standards, ensuring longevity

The Importance of Accessibility

Accessibility is no longer an afterthought but a fundamental requirement for modern web applications. WCAG 2.1 guidelines are becoming the standard for web accessibility.

Key Accessibility Features

  • Semantic HTML structure
  • Keyboard navigation support
  • Screen reader compatibility
  • Color contrast compliance

Conclusion

As we move through 2024, web developers need to stay updated with these trends to create better, faster, and more accessible web applications. The focus on performance, modern frameworks, AI tools, and accessibility will continue to shape the industry.

The future of web development is exciting, and those who adapt to these changes will be well-positioned to create exceptional user experiences.